#ce0bee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ce0bee is composed of 80.8% red, 4.3%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.4%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 291.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 48.8%. #ce0bee color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#9d00dd.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

#ce0bee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ce0bee has RGB values of R:206, G:11,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 13503470.

Hex triplet ce0bee #ce0bee
RGB Decimal 206, 11, 238 rgb(206,11,238)
RGB Percent 80.8, 4.3, 93.3 rgb(80.8%,4.3%,93.3%)
CMYK 13, 95, 0, 7
HSL 291.5°, 91.2, 48.8 hsl(291.5,91.2%,48.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 291.5°, 95.4, 93.3
Web Safe cc00ff #cc00ff
CIE-LAB 51.309, 87.679, -66.278
XYZ 41.004, 19.536, 82.495
xyY 0.287, 0.137, 19.536
CIE-LCH 51.309, 109.911, 322.914
CIE-LUV 51.309, 56.164, -110.715
Hunter-Lab 44.2, 88.244, -79.719
Binary 11001110, 00001011, 11101110

Shades and Tints of #ce0bee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010d is the darkest color, while #fef9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ce0bee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827485 is the less saturated color, while #d501f8 is the most saturated one.
